On Time Services Salary

As of May 2026, the average annual salary for employees at On Time Services in the United States is $74,820.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$36. Salaries at On Time Services typically range from $65,640 to $85,171 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

What Is the Cost of Living Near New Bedford?

Understanding the cost of living near New Bedford is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at On Time Services.
New Bedford's Cost of Living Index is approximately 103.2 (3.2% more expensive than US average; 22.2% less than MA average). South Coast historic whaling city, more affordable housing. SRTA bus, Commuter Rail (future). When planning your budget based on a salary from On Time Services,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,200 - $1,700+ A significant portion of On Time Services sal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$190 - $300 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$40 (SRTA mon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$430 - $630 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$350 - $650+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$390 - $720+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,600 - $4,000+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
